- Title
- Dog Saddlebag
- Date
- prior to 1970
- Material
- skin
- Dimensions
- 21.0 x 41.0 cm
- Description
- Two small bags joined with a strip of hide, to be worn over a dog’s back, made from smoked hide. Each bag has two ties used to fasten bag shut and a forked leather tag at each bottom corner. Tag with CRW writing: “Dog Pack made by Eliza Hunter.”
- Subject
- Indigenous
- Stoney
- Eliza Hunter
- animals, dogs
- crafts
